Three on a Match Poster

Three on a Match

Three wise girls who barred no holds and bit in the clinches.
1932 | 63m | English

(4742 votes)

TMDb IMDb

Popularity: 2 (history)

Details

Although Vivian Revere is seemingly the most successful of a trio of reunited schoolmates, she throws it away by descending into a life of debauchery and drugs.
Release Date: Oct 29, 1932
Director: Mervyn LeRoy
Writer: Lucien Hubbard, Kubec Glasmon, John Bright
Genres: Drama, Crime
